ORIGINAL: Mike Solli Welcome to the forum, DW! Actually, planes use supply for fuel. Only ships use fuel for fuel. That's not your problem. The problem is that air unit is attached to a restricted HQ. You need to click on that HQ (upper left of the screen) and use PPs to change it to a different HQ. Once you do that, you'll be able to move the air unit out of the US. Are you trying to transfer the unit to a base in the US? If so, you should be able to do it. But you'll still need to change the HQ in order to load it on a ship. Thanks for you quick response. Ok... I've tried what you suggested. Both squadrons were attached to West Coast HQ. I tried transferring them to South Pacific HQ, Central Pacific HQ and Southwest Pacific HQ. I even tried letting the game cycle through a turn after I changed the HQ. Nothing worked. The transfer to base option is still unavailable, as are the transfer to ship, disband group and withdrawal options. Upgrade is, however, an available option. I thought of trying to change the HQ of Portland base, but that's not allowed. Any other suggestions? Cuz, I just had another squadron of fighters arrive when I was testing your suggestion, and I can't move them either. If it goes on like this the entire game I'm going to have a lot of fighters unavailable. Thanks. Did you have enough Political Points (PPs) to transfer them? At the beginning of the game (in stock), PPs are very limited, and you might not be able to transfer them for a few turns.
